Output edb889acf57500109547959a8a2807c945538663723f5173113c0fe3c42f0046:11

value
66550
script pubkey
OP_0 OP_PUSHBYTES_20 b104b1d018cdf0e8f31dad295a80f236c64730b8
address
bc1qkyztr5qcehcw3uca45544q8jxmrywv9c0ugnur
transaction
edb889acf57500109547959a8a2807c945538663723f5173113c0fe3c42f0046
spent
true